Susan Boyle - I Dreamed A Dream
I Dreamed A Dream is the forthcoming debut album from Scottish singer Susan Boyle. It is due to be released on 23 November 2009.
The 12-track CD includes her take on ten famous songs and her incredible pipes
have more than done them justice.
I can see
it being one of the biggest-sellers of the decade.
A highlight of the album is her version of ROLLING STONES' classic Wild
Horses. It's a brave move - but the result is a cracker.
Her take on THE MONKEES' chirpy Daydream Believer is a moving, gentle
piano ballad.
Amazing Grace, where she is joined by a gospel choir, is rousing to say the
least and she showcases a real knack for the blues with Cry Me A River.
SuBo also puts her stamp on hymns and her original efforts are called Proud
and Who I Was Born To Be.
It's incredibly classy stuff throughout. A star is born.
